Pain receptors, often called nociceptors, are specialised nerves that detect harm or prospective harm to tissue and transmit this data for the brain. Your body then sends out protecting responses for instance wincing or withdrawing from painful stimuli.

Nociceptors had been identified by Charles Scott Sherrington in 1906. In earlier generations, scientists believed that animals ended up like mechanical gadgets that transformed the Power of sensory stimuli into motor responses. Sherrington utilised a variety of experiments to demonstrate that different types of stimulation to an afferent nerve fiber's receptive subject brought about distinct responses.

Nociceptors develop from neural-crest stem cells all through embryogenesis. The neural crest is chargeable for a substantial part of early growth in vertebrates. It really is specifically responsible for growth of your peripheral anxious technique (PNS). The neural-crest stem cells break up from your neural tube since it closes, and nociceptors improve within the dorsal element of the neural-crest tissue.
